Original Description
Govert Flinck's Young Shepherdess as Flora (c. 1636) is a radiant portrayal of youthful innocence infused with classical symbolism. The painting depicts a young shepherdess adorned with flowers, embodying Flora, the Roman goddess of spring and blossoms. Flinck, a prominent pupil of Rembrandt, masterfully blends Baroque naturalism with delicate elegance—soft, glowing light caresses her face, while richly textured fabrics and floral details showcase his meticulous brushwork. Historians note this work reflects Flinck’s shift toward a more refined, idealized style influenced by Flemish masters like Van Dyck. Though lesser-known than Rembrandt, Flinck’s contributions to Dutch Golden Age portraiture remain significant, particularly his ability to merge mythological grandeur with intimate charm. The painting’s warm hues and serene expression evoke a timeless pastoral idyll, making it a captivating example of 17th-century Dutch narrative portraiture.
